Default Cigarette Mystique - whose the expert

I was wanting to get some info on the Mystique, about how many of them were built and during what years and how have they held up over the years.

I was wondering how they would take the LOTO Summer Saturday afternoon slop, they don't have a molded swim platform so they truly are 30', unlike my 353 Formula which is 35' 3", but it has almost 2' of molded swim platform which makes the true hull only 33'.

Anyone have any experience with them and can share any info with me, thanks.

Yup Kurt (biggus)would know and I saw it running this yr at LOTO and will say it handled well. They only made 4 t/s and his by far is the nicest. Supposably lipship is in the process of redoing one as we speak. I heard from a good resource that the main reason Cig stopped making them was there was no profit on them as we all know Skip is all about profit and biz so it didn't make sense.
